Concrete Cylinder Curing Box, 165qt., Heat Only

New way to protect concrete test specimens in the field. Thermostatically controlled for that “Set it and forget it” setup. Great for curing test specimens in the fall/winter. 1/3 the cost of some of the other models out there. Now with a 165 qt. Grizzly hard sided cooler with continuous circulation fan. Economy model has basic heating only with 1500 watt heater and dial thermometer. This curing box ensures the concrete achieves its ultimate strength by maintaining optimal environmental conditions.

Concrete Curing Box heat only. 34gal (156L) volume capacity. Holds up to 12- 6x12” cylnder molds & 50- 4x8” cylinder molds with flat lids. Concrete provide essential environments for curing.

Lightweight Perfa-Cure Concrete Curing Box (165qt. Heat Only) keeps the required initial curing temperatures of 60°–80°F (16°–27°C) and provides portable storage and protection for concrete test specimens. Just plug it in and set the thermostat to the desired temperature. Models meet current ASTM C31 and AASHTO T 23 standards for initial curing of concretetestspecimens in the field. This curing box provides an ideal environment within an ambient range of -10°–100°F (-23°–37.8°C).Hard-sided insulated curing box has tie-down slots for transport and rubber lid gasket to keep internal temperatures stable. Heater panel on inner lid and cooling concrete test cylinders boxes are replaceable. Max-min registering thermometer inside the box monitors temperature conditions. Heating panel has a safe aluminum base to radiate heat. Reliable results depend on choosing the right model based on specific needs.

Perfa-Cure boxes run on 110V, 60Hz. Capacity is based on cylinders with flat plastic lids. Need heat and AC for your concrete curing? Get the Concrete Curing Box (165qt. Heat/AC)
